NCDENR- Waste Management offers grants to North Carolina businesses for recycling and reuse of processed scrap tires. Grant proposals are welcomed and continually accepted throughout the year. The purpose of this grant program is to reduce the flow of scrap tires to disposal facilities and encourage the sustainable recovery of materials from North Carolina's waste stream. To achieve that purpose, the Division of Waste Management seeks viable, well-planned and effective proposals from recycling businesses in North Carolina wanting to start up or expand recycling and reuse efforts of processed scrap tires. Examples of such uses are tire-derived fuel, crumb rubber, carbon black, or other components of tires for use in products such as fuel, tires, mats, auto parts, gaskets, flooring material, or other applications of processed tire materials. Projects involving the collection or end use of processed scrap tires in the solid waste stream are eligible for funding. Generally, the grant money is intended to fund sustainable investments in equipment and buildings necessary for starting or increasing the capacity of a recycling business to divert more materials from disposal and into economic use. Grant money cannot be used to cover cost of processing scrap tires.
